You can’t fuel your rocket without gas. Funding your account at a US space casino is seamless, but withdrawal speeds vary wildly depending on your method. If you stick to the licensed operators, you won't have issues with payments vanishing into a black hole.
PayPal and Venmo are the gold standards. At FanDuel or DraftKings, withdrawing to PayPal often processes within 24 hours. Play+ cards are another favorite; they function like a prepaid debit card specifically for the casino. Load it with a credit card, play, and withdraw instantly to the card. ACH (e-check) is reliable but slower, sometimes taking 3-5 business days to clear. Avoid wire transfers unless you are moving large sums ($10k+), as they often incur fees and require a trip to your bank branch. Crypto is generally not available at state-licensed US casinos due to regulatory hurdles, so if you see a "space casino" pushing Bitcoin bonuses hard, it is likely an unregulated offshore site you should avoid.

This is the most critical section. You cannot simply play any online casino from anywhere in the US. If you try to log into a space casino online from California, you will be geo-blocked unless the operator is a sweepstakes model (like Stake.us or Chumba). Real-money space slots are strictly limited to states that have passed iGaming legislation.
Currently, you can legally play these games in New Jersey, Pennsylvania, Michigan, West Virginia, and Connecticut. Delaware recently limited its market to a single operator (BetRivers). If you are physically located in these states, the GPS on your phone will verify your location before you can wager. This legal protection ensures the games are audited for fairness by state gaming commissions—meaning the RTP on that space slot is actually what the provider says it is. If you play on an offshore site, you have zero recourse if they refuse to pay a jackpot.

No, provided you play at a licensed US casino. Games like Starburst use Random Number Generators (RNG) that are tested by independent labs like GLI or eCOGRA. The house always has an edge (usually 3-5% on slots), but the outcome of every spin is random and cannot be manipulated by the casino.

Yes. In the US, gambling winnings are considered taxable income by the IRS. If you win $600 or more at a site like BetMGM, the casino will likely issue you a W-2G form. You are required to report all gambling winnings on your tax return, regardless of the amount.
